27 static int fake_filesystems(void) {
28 static const struct fakefs {
29 const char *src;
30 const char *target;
31 const char *error;
32 bool ignore_mount_error;
33 } fakefss[] = {
34 { "test/tmpfs/sys", "/sys", "Failed to mount test /sys", false },
35 { "test/tmpfs/dev", "/dev", "Failed to mount test /dev", false },
36 { "test/run", "/run", "Failed to mount test /run", false },
37 { "test/run", "/etc/udev/rules.d", "Failed to mount empty /etc/udev/rules.d", true },
38 { "test/run", UDEVLIBEXECDIR "/rules.d", "Failed to mount empty " UDEVLIBEXECDIR "/rules.d", true },
39 };
40 unsigned i;
41
42 if (unshare(CLONE_NEWNS) < 0)
43 return log_error_errno(errno, "Failed to call unshare(): %m");
44
45 if (mount(NULL, "/", NULL, MS_SLAVE|MS_REC, NULL) < 0)
46 return log_error_errno(errno, "Failed to mount / as private: %m");
47
48 for (i = 0; i < ELEMENTSOF(fakefss); i++)
49 if (mount(fakefss[i].src, fakefss[i].target, NULL, MS_BIND, NULL) < 0) {
50 log_full_errno(fakefss[i].ignore_mount_error ? LOG_DEBUG : LOG_ERR, errno, "%s: %m", fakefss[i].error);
51 if (!fakefss[i].ignore_mount_error)
52 return -errno;
53 }
54
55 return 0;
56 }

58 static int run(int argc, char *argv[]) {
59 _cleanup_(udev_rules_freep) UdevRules *rules = NULL;
60 _cleanup_(udev_event_freep) UdevEvent *event = NULL;
61 _cleanup_(sd_device_unrefp) sd_device *dev = NULL;
62 const char *devpath, *devname, *action;
63 int r;
64
65 test_setup_logging(LOG_INFO);
66
67 if (!IN_SET(argc, 2, 3)) {
68 log_error("This program needs one or two arguments, %d given", argc - 1);
69 return -EINVAL;
70 }
71
72 r = fake_filesystems();
73 if (r < 0)
74 return r;
75
76 if (argc == 2) {
77 if (!streq(argv[1], "check")) {
78 log_error("Unknown argument: %s", argv[1]);
79 return -EINVAL;
80 }
81
82 return 0;
83 }
84
85 log_debug("version %s", GIT_VERSION);
86 mac_selinux_init();
87
88 action = argv[1];
89 devpath = argv[2];
90
91 assert_se(udev_rules_new(&rules, RESOLVE_NAME_EARLY) == 0);
92
93 const char *syspath = strjoina("/sys", devpath);
94 r = device_new_from_synthetic_event(&dev, syspath, action);
95 if (r < 0)
96 return log_debug_errno(r, "Failed to open device '%s'", devpath);
97
98 assert_se(event = udev_event_new(dev, 0, NULL));
99
100 assert_se(sigprocmask_many(SIG_BLOCK, NULL, SIGTERM, SIGINT, SIGHUP, SIGCHLD, -1) >= 0);
101
102 /* do what devtmpfs usually provides us */
103 if (sd_device_get_devname(dev, &devname) >= 0) {
104 const char *subsystem;
105 mode_t mode = 0600;
106
107 if (sd_device_get_subsystem(dev, &subsystem) >= 0 && streq(subsystem, "block"))
108 mode |= S_IFBLK;
109 else
110 mode |= S_IFCHR;
111
112 if (!streq(action, "remove")) {
113 dev_t devnum = makedev(0, 0);
114
115 (void) mkdir_parents_label(devname, 0755);
116 (void) sd_device_get_devnum(dev, &devnum);
117 if (mknod(devname, mode, devnum) < 0)
118 return log_error_errno(errno, "mknod() failed for '%s': %m", devname);
119 } else {
120 if (unlink(devname) < 0)
121 return log_error_errno(errno, "unlink('%s') failed: %m", devname);
122 (void) rmdir_parents(devname, "/");
123 }
124 }
125
126 udev_event_execute_rules(event, 3 * USEC_PER_SEC, NULL, rules);
127 udev_event_execute_run(event, 3 * USEC_PER_SEC);
128
129 return 0;
130 }
131
132 DEFINE_MAIN_FUNCTION(run);
